How long will the furniture last?
Teak furniture is made of one of nature’s most durable renewable building materials. Teak has been used for centuries for building construction, shipbuilding and furniture construction. Teak furniture has withstood the test of time in public areas around England with many pieces still in use after 100 years. Your furniture will also give decades of service without requiring the constant care that some other types of outdoor furniture demand.

How is the wood finished?
Domus Designs offers the full line of furniture in natural teak finish. Natural teak will gradually change to a beautiful silver gray patina with exposure to the elements. Alternately, we offer a teak protector with UV and mildew resistant agents that will prolong the honey gold color of natural teak. This type of protectant will not darken like oil. Does the production of teak furniture hurt the environment?
Unlike metal or plastic, teakwood is a renewable resource. Teak furniture’s ability to last for decades even centuries makes it environmentally friendly in comparison to other man made furnishings that eventually end up in a landfill. We use only teak from plantations in Indonesia that are supervised by a division of the state forest ministry. This ensures that the resource is managed in a sustainable manner and the forests of Indonesia are preserved for future generations. It is interesting to note that as a result of the efforts of the Indonesian Government, more teak is growing today than 100 years ago.
What about the quality?
Teakwood is commercially available from the Indonesian Government in several grades. The best furniture quality grade is "Mutu Pertama" or "First Quality" which means that the lumber is taken from the best part of the log with tight grain and no loose knots or checks. Furniture from Domus Designs uses "First Quality" teak exclusively. All lumber is kiln dried before manufacturing and assembly. Our furniture is precision machine cut from heavy timbers and uses the time proven mortise and tenon or tongue and groove joinery methods. Structural joints are doweled and glued with waterproof polyurethane furniture glue for a lifetime of vigorous outdoor use.
